    Traffic Control Technician III (Sign) - Baldwin County CommissionSalary$21.18 HourlyLocationBay Minette, ALJob TypeFull-TimeDepartmentHighway Department - Baldwin County CommissionDivisionTraffic OperationsOpening Date05/13/2026Closing Date5/27/2026 11:59 PM Central* Description* Benefits* QuestionsPosition DescriptionResponsible for serving as crew leader to carry out the activities of the Traffic Control sign crew. Work involves the following: physical placement of traffic signs as required throughout the county while insuring all signage meets MUTCD Standards. Placement of detours as needed. Performing complex traffic control operations.Capturing data on all signage with County issued tablets to ensure GIS is updated. This requires general skills and knowledge to operate computers and software programs. Willing to assist other crews within the department as needed.This position requires driving as an essential function of the position. For Baldwin County driving requirements, please see the following link: Driver Qualifications. Successful applicants must be at least 20 years old, insurable by the County's insurance carrier, pass a criminal and motor vehicle background check and will be subject to a pre-employment drug test and physical.Essential Job FunctionsOperations* Operate sign truck to install traffic control signs including post driver and puller.* Operate sign truck with aerial bucket to trim limbs and precisely cut brush as needed.* May operate other equipment as deemed necessary by Supervisor.* May operate other equipment such as the asphalt spreader, roller, paint truck or tractor.* Perform routine manual labor on other crews as needed.* Ensure that all signs are in proper placement by current MUTCD standards.* Ensure that all traffic control operations meet current MUTCD standards.* Willing to respond to call outs when deemed necessary by the Supervisor.Equipment Maintenance* Prior to operating equipment; perform safety and maintenance inspection of assigned equipment.* Perform light maintenance and servicing in connection with equipment operated.* Notify supervisor of mechanical or safety problems.* May assist mechanic or other repairmen with mechanical repairs.Education and Experience* Five (5) years' experience in Traffic Control.* Valid Commercial Driver's License (CDL - Class B) and be insurable by the County's insurance standards.Other Characteristics* Required to wear uniforms as directed by County Engineer.* Willing to work overtime and non-standard hours as needed.* Willing to travel for school and training.* Assist in Disaster Recovery efforts as needed.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ities* Skills to communicate information to supervisors and co-workers.* Skills to complete routine forms and records.* Basic skills to operate computers and software programs.* Basic skills in the operation, maintenance and safe use of aerial buckets and lifts.* Moderate skills in the operation, maintenance and safe use of trucks, tractors and heavy equipment.* Knowledge of traffic regulations.* Knowledge of ALDOT standard drawings and how to apply these standards to real world applications.* Knowledge of The Manual of Uniform Traffic Control Devices and how to apply the manual to real world applications.* Knowledge of safety rules including accident causes and prevention.* Ability to work independently without close supervision.* Knowledge of county policies, procedures and rules.Physical Characteristics* See well enough to operate equipment and motor vehicles; corrective lens acceptable.* Hear well enough to understand oral instructions, carry on conservation with public and workers; hearing aid acceptable.* Speak well enough to meet and converse with the public, convey instructions to others, communicate by telephone and two-way radio.* Body movement to place traffic markings and signs, operate equipment, operate motor vehicles, handle signs and hand tools.* Strength to lift 50 pounds, use hand tools, repair flashing signals and operate motor vehicles.* Must be able to stand all day.Baldwin County Commission and Baldwin County Sheriff's Office does not discriminate on the basis of race, color, national origin, sex, religion, age, marital status, disability, citizenship or veteran status in employment.
